  • Title

    Block DCT-based robust watermarking using side information extracted by mean filtering

  • Abstract
    A novel watermarking method is presented based on the concept of communications with side information. We investigate the characteristic of mean filtering to formalize the problems of watermark embedding and extraction. This leads to a non-additive embedding strategy and a sophisticated blind detection mechanism. With regard to geometric attacks (without cropping), block-based watermarking and moment normalization are both addressed without relying on pilot signals. The new watermarking scheme has been verified by Stirmark and a new benchmark.
